Sony Xperia PRO-I has an overall score of 96.3, which is a bit better than the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 2's 94.6 overall score. Both phones in this comparison review come with the same Android 11 operating system. The Sony Xperia PRO-I is a newer and way lighter cellphone than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 2, although it is also noticeably thicker.
Sony Xperia PRO-I counts with a brighter screen than Galaxy Z Fold 2, because although it has a little smaller screen, it also counts with a much better pixel density and a higher 1644 x 3840 pixels resolution. Galaxy Z Fold 2 features a little faster CPU than Sony Xperia PRO-I. Both of them have the same number of cores and a 12 GB RAM.
The Xperia PRO-I counts with a very superior memory capacity to store more games and applications than Galaxy Z Fold 2, because it has 512 GB internal storage capacity and a slot for an SD memory card that allows up to 1 TB.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 2 has a bit better camera than Xperia PRO-I, because although it has slower 60 frames per second video frame rates, and they both have a same resolution camera in the back and the same 3840x2160 video definition, the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 2 also counts with a much larger back camera sensor providing a way higher image quality and a larger camera aperture.
Xperia PRO-I and Galaxy Z Fold 2 both have extremely similar battery durations.
